Top 5 Low Poly Games Performance in Romania Q3 2021
Discover how the top 5 low poly games performed on a unified platform in Romania during Q3 2021, with insights on weekly downloads, revenue, and active users.
In Q3 2021, the top 5 low poly games on a unified platform in Romania exhibited notable trends in weekly downloads, revenue, and active users. This data, sourced from Sensor Tower, highlights the performance of Roblox, Art of War: Legions, Idle Lumber Empire - Wood Game, Triviador, and Egg, Inc..
Roblox experienced a steady increase in weekly revenue, peaking at approximately $61K in mid-August. Weekly downloads showed an upward trend, reaching around 17.5K in late August, while weekly active users saw a slight fluctuation, averaging around 990K throughout the quarter.
Art of War: Legions had a notable increase in weekly downloads, peaking at 1.95K in late September. Weekly revenue varied, with a peak of about $10.9K in early July. Active users fluctuated, averaging around 13.9K, with a peak of 14.7K in late August.
Idle Lumber Empire - Wood Game saw a significant rise in weekly downloads, peaking at 19.5K in late September. Weekly revenue showed moderate increases, with a peak of $667 in mid-July. Active users experienced a significant increase, reaching around 31K by the end of September.
Triviador maintained steady weekly downloads, peaking at approximately 9.6K in early September. Weekly revenue showed consistent growth, with a peak of $294 in late September. Active users averaged around 17.5K, peaking at 21.6K in early September.
Egg, Inc. had a steady increase in weekly downloads, peaking at 716 in mid-September. Weekly revenue remained relatively stable, peaking at $206 in early September. Active users saw a gradual increase, reaching around 2.9K by the end of the quarter.
